隅田川花火大会 (Sumida River Fireworks Festival)
Let's kick things off with a true legend: the Sumida River Fireworks Festival! This one's a classic, guys, with a history stretching back centuries. Imagine fireworks reflecting on the water, the Tokyo skyline as your backdrop… it’s pure magic. The Sumida River Fireworks Festival is not just a fireworks display; it's a cultural event that has been celebrated for generations. Its origins can be traced back to the Edo period, when fireworks were used to ward off evil spirits and pray for good health. Today, the festival continues to honor this tradition, bringing communities together to enjoy the beauty of the fireworks and the festive atmosphere. The festival typically features two main venues along the Sumida River, each hosting its own spectacular display. This allows for a wider viewing area and ensures that more people can enjoy the show. The fireworks are launched from barges on the river, creating a stunning visual effect as the bursts reflect off the water's surface. The combination of the dazzling fireworks, the iconic Tokyo skyline, and the historic setting makes this festival a truly unique and unforgettable experience. 神奈川新聞花火大会 (Kanagawa Shimbun Fireworks Festival)
Okay, next up we have the Kanagawa Shimbun Fireworks Festival, held in Yokohama. This festival is known for its massive scale and innovative displays. Picture this: thousands of fireworks lighting up Yokohama's vibrant cityscape. Amazing, right? The Kanagawa Shimbun Fireworks Festival is a major event in the Yokohama calendar, attracting crowds from all over the Kanto region. The festival is known for its grand scale, with thousands of fireworks launched over the course of the evening. The displays are carefully choreographed to music, creating a dynamic and immersive experience for the audience. The fireworks themselves are a testament to the artistry and skill of Japanese pyrotechnicians. They come in a wide variety of shapes, sizes, and colors, each one designed to create a unique visual effect. From traditional chrysanthemum bursts to modern, abstract designs, the fireworks at this festival are sure to impress. The Yokohama setting adds to the festival's appeal. The city's skyline, with its iconic landmarks and glittering lights, provides a stunning backdrop for the fireworks display. You can watch the fireworks from various locations along the waterfront, including parks, promenades, and even boats. Many people choose to gather in Yamashita Park, a popular green space that offers excellent views of the fireworks. If you're looking for a more unique experience, consider taking a harbor cruise during the festival. This will give you a front-row seat to the fireworks, with the added bonus of enjoying the city lights from the water. 幕張ビーチ花火フェスタ (Makuhari Beach Fireworks Festa)
For a beachy vibe, you've gotta check out the Makuhari Beach Fireworks Festa! Fireworks + the ocean breeze? Yes, please! This festival usually features a super creative theme, so expect something really unique. The Makuhari Beach Fireworks Festa is a popular summer event held on the shores of Makuhari Beach in Chiba Prefecture. This festival offers a unique combination of dazzling fireworks and a relaxed beach atmosphere, making it a perfect way to spend a summer evening. The location on Makuhari Beach provides a spacious viewing area, allowing you to spread out and enjoy the show without feeling too crowded. You can bring a blanket or beach chair, relax on the sand, and watch the fireworks light up the night sky over the ocean. The sound of the waves crashing in the background adds to the ambiance, creating a truly magical experience. The festival is known for its creative and innovative displays. Each year, the organizers choose a theme that inspires the fireworks designs and music selection. This means that you can expect something new and exciting every time you attend the festival. The fireworks are often synchronized to music, creating a seamless blend of visual and auditory spectacle. The displays may include intricate patterns, vibrant colors, and even pyrotechnic effects that tell a story. In addition to the fireworks, the Makuhari Beach Fireworks Festa typically features a variety of food stalls and entertainment options. You can grab a bite to eat, enjoy live music, and participate in various activities before and after the fireworks show. This makes it a great event for families and groups of friends. 花火大会を楽しむためのヒント (Tips for Enjoying Fireworks Festivals)
Alright, now that we've talked about some amazing festivals, let's get into some essential tips for enjoying fireworks festivals to the fullest. Trust me, a little planning goes a long way! To truly make the most of your fireworks festival experience, a bit of preparation can make all the difference. Fireworks festivals are incredibly popular events, drawing large crowds eager to witness the stunning displays. To ensure you have a fantastic time, it's crucial to plan ahead and be well-prepared. Arriving early to secure a good viewing spot is paramount. The best locations tend to fill up quickly, so setting up your spot several hours in advance is advisable, especially for the most popular festivals. Bring along a comfortable blanket or chairs to make your wait more enjoyable. Pack some snacks and drinks to keep you refreshed while you wait and during the show. Remember to dispose of any trash responsibly to help keep the venue clean. Check the weather forecast before you leave home and dress appropriately. Even on warm summer evenings, temperatures can drop once the sun goes down, so bringing a light jacket or sweater is a good idea. If rain is in the forecast, consider bringing an umbrella or raincoat, but be mindful of obstructing the views of those around you. Public transportation is often the most convenient way to get to and from fireworks festivals, as traffic congestion can be heavy and parking limited. Check the train and bus schedules in advance, and be prepared for potential delays due to the crowds. Walking or cycling to the venue is also a great option if you live nearby. Finally, remember to stay hydrated and protect yourself from the sun. Bring plenty of water to drink, and wear sunscreen and a hat if you'll be spending time in the sun before the fireworks begin. 持ち物チェックリスト (What to Bring Checklist)
Let's talk essentials for your fireworks adventure! I've put together a little checklist to make sure you're prepared for anything. Having the right gear can significantly enhance your experience at a fireworks festival, ensuring you're comfortable, prepared, and ready to fully enjoy the spectacle. A well-packed bag can make the difference between a fantastic evening and one filled with minor inconveniences. So, let's run through a checklist of essential items to bring along. First and foremost, seating is crucial. A comfortable blanket or folding chairs will allow you to relax and enjoy the show without having to stand for hours. Consider the terrain of the viewing area and choose seating options that are appropriate for the surface. Next, pack some snacks and drinks to keep yourself and your companions fueled and hydrated throughout the evening. Fireworks festivals often have food stalls, but they can be crowded and expensive, so bringing your own refreshments is a smart move. Choose items that are easy to transport and consume, such as sandwiches, fruits, and bottled water. Don't forget to bring trash bags to dispose of any waste responsibly. As the evening progresses, temperatures can drop, so it's always wise to bring a light jacket or sweater to stay warm. A portable fan can also be useful for staying cool during the warmer parts of the day. Other essential items include a fully charged phone or camera to capture the dazzling displays, a portable charger to keep your devices powered up, and a flashlight or headlamp for navigating the crowds and finding your way back to your transportation. Cash is also a good idea, as some vendors may not accept credit cards. Finally, consider bringing insect repellent to ward off mosquitoes and other bugs, and a first-aid kit for any minor injuries or ailments.
